American Fusion Inc. (OTC: AMFN) has announced the filing of six additional U.S. patent applications, expanding its intellectual property portfolio to 82 U.S. patent applications. The new filings cover multiple aspects of its proprietary Texatron(TM) Fusion Engine(TM), including reactor architecture, plasma confinement, electromagnetic systems, and related technologies. This strategic expansion underscores the company’s commitment to protecting innovations across the fusion engine’s core technologies as it advances toward commercialization.
The company also provided updates on several corporate and engineering initiatives. Notably, American Fusion is responding to what it believes are the final comments on its Form 211 application, the last regulatory step before potential eligibility for quotation on the OTCQB Market, subject to applicable requirements. This move could enhance the company’s visibility and liquidity, providing a platform for broader investor participation.
In addition, American Fusion is preparing the next phase of Texatron testing at Texas Tech University. Upcoming evaluations will focus on subsystem verification, control and fuel systems, plasma and magnetic field controls, and equipment calibration. These tests are designed to further refine system performance and support continued development of the fusion platform.
